Initial Public Offerings. The Fund may invest a portion of its assets in
initial public offerings ("IPOs"), which are typically securities of small,
unseasoned issuers. By definition, IPOs have not traded publicly until the
time of their offerings. Certain risks associated with IPOs may include a
limited number of shares available for trading, unseasoned trading, lack of
investor knowledge of the company, and limited operating history, all of
which may contribute to price volatility. The limited number of shares
available for trading in some IPOs may make it more difficult for the Fund
to buy or sell significant amounts of shares without an unfavorable impact
on prevailing prices. Some companies involved in new industries may be
regarded as developmental stage companies, without revenues or operating
income, or near-term prospects of such.
